The Importance of Removing Existing Varnish from Hardwood Floors Before Refinishing

Refinishing a hardwood floor is an excellent way to breathe new life into your home and restore the natural beauty of your flooring. However, before embarking on a refinishing project, it is crucial to remove the existing varnish or finish from your hardwood floors. While this step may require additional time and effort, it is crucial for achieving a successful and long-lasting refinishing result. why you should remove your hardwood floor’s existing varnish before commencing with any hardwood refinishing work:

Achieve a Smooth and Even Surface

One of the primary reasons for removing the existing varnish is to create a smooth and even surface for the new finish. Over time, varnish can wear down, become scratched, or develop an uneven appearance. By removing the existing varnish, you can eliminate any imperfections, such as indentations or blemishes, and ensure a flawless finish.

Enhance Adhesion of the New Finish

Applying a new finish directly over the existing varnish may seem like a time-saving step, but it can result in poor adhesion of the new finish. The new finish needs to bond directly with the wood fibers to provide long-lasting protection and maintain its appearance over time. If the existing varnish is left in place, it can act as a barrier, preventing the new finish from adhering properly. This can lead to premature wear, peeling, or flaking of the finish.

Eliminate Surface Contaminants

Over time, dirt, grime, and other contaminants can accumulate on the surface of your hardwood floors. If you apply a new finish directly over these contaminants, they can become trapped beneath the new finish, affecting its appearance and performance. By removing the existing varnish, you can thoroughly clean the surface and ensure that no unwanted substances are sealed into the new finish. This will result in a cleaner, healthier, and more attractive floor.
